If I become a major in another engineering department, can I minor in CSE?
No. If you are a major in any department of the Jacobs School of Engineering at UCSD, you may not take a minor in the CSE Department.

What is the difference between computer science and math/computer science?
The two majors differ in their emphasis and in their lists of required courses. The math/computer science major has many fewer required computer science and engineering courses and more required mathematics courses. Again, you should contact a Mathematics Department advisor for details.
